How Much Do Education Graduates from Evangel University Make?

$34,527 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Education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Education maj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Evangel University earn a median of $34,527 a year. This is below $40,330, the median for all majors at Evangel University.

How Much Student Debt Do Education Graduates from Evangel University Have?

$28,588 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Education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

While getting their bachelor’s degree at Evangel University, education students accumulate a median of $28,588 in student loans. This is higher than $25,610, the typical median for all majors at Evangel University.

Evangel University Education Bachelor’s Program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 31% of education bachelor’s degrees went to men and 69% went to women.

Evangel University gender breakdown of Education Bachelor's degree grads

The largest share of education bachelor’s degree graduates at Evangel University are White. About 90%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Evangel University with a bachelor’s in education.

Ethnic diversity of Education majors at Evangel University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 2
White 43
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 3
